Maximizing Your Retirement Savings: A Guide To Combining Workplace Pensions

When it comes to planning for retirement, having a solid pension plan in place is crucial For many individuals, their workplace pension serves as a key component of their overall retirement savings strategy However, what happens when you have multiple workplace pensions from different jobs? Is it possible to combine them to maximize your savings potential? The answer is yes, and in this article, we will explore the benefits of combining workplace pensions and how you can go about doing so.

First and foremost, having multiple workplace pensions can make it difficult to keep track of your retirement savings Each pension may have different contribution rates, investment options, and administrative fees, making it hard to get a clear picture of your overall financial situation By consolidating your pensions, you can simplify your retirement planning process and have a better understanding of how much you have saved and how much more you need to save to reach your retirement goals.

Combining your workplace pensions can also lead to cost savings Many pension providers charge administrative fees for managing your account, and having multiple pensions means paying multiple sets of fees By consolidating your pensions, you can potentially reduce the total amount of fees you are paying and keep more of your hard-earned money working for you in your retirement fund.

Furthermore, combining workplace pensions can give you more control over your investments When you have multiple pensions, each one may have its own set of investment options, which can make it challenging to create a diversified portfolio that aligns with your risk tolerance and investment goals By consolidating your pensions, you can have more flexibility in choosing the investments that are right for you and your financial situation.

So, how exactly do you go about combining your workplace pensions? The first step is to gather all the necessary information about your existing pensions, including the names of the pension providers, account numbers, and any other relevant details Once you have this information, you can contact your current pension providers and inquire about the process of transferring or combining your pensions.

However, it is important to consult with a financial advisor or tax professional to ensure that you are following the appropriate procedures and maximizing the benefits of combining your workplace pensions.

When combining workplace pensions, it is also crucial to consider the investment options available to you Take the time to review the different funds and assets offered by each pension provider and choose the ones that best align with your investment goals and risk tolerance Diversifying your investments can help reduce risk and potentially increase your overall returns over time.

Additionally, it is important to keep in mind that combining workplace pensions may not be the right choice for everyone Before making any decisions, take the time to carefully assess your individual financial situation, retirement goals, and tax implications Consulting with a financial advisor can help you make informed decisions and create a retirement savings strategy that works best for you.
